The Border Randonnee cycle event returns

Entries have opened for a delightful road cycling event on the Shropshire / Powys border on Saturday 9th May 2026.

The Border Randonnee cycle event is organised by Rotary Club of Shrewsbury Darwin to encourage cycling and raise funds for Shrewsbury Food Hub and other local charities.

The event starts and finishes at Minsterley Village Hall and there are three scenic routes for cyclists looking to take part:

• Short: 33 miles
• Medium: 59 miles
• Long: 70 miles

E-bikes are welcome to join the short route. The entry fee is £30, and all entry fees will be donated to charity. Refreshments will be provided.

This year, the event is welcoming e-bikes on the short route and encouraging corporate teams to take the challenge.
